What Makes a Colorist the Best Choice for Curly Hair?
The best colorist for curly hair possesses specific skills and knowledge that cater to the unique needs of textured hair.
- Understanding of Curly Hair Texture: A top colorist for curly hair has a deep understanding of how different types of curls react to color treatments. They know that curly hair may require different approaches compared to straight hair, particularly because of its structure and porosity, which can affect how color is absorbed and retained.
- Experience with Color Techniques: The best colorists are proficient in specialized coloring techniques suitable for curls, such as balayage or ombre. These methods allow for a more natural-looking finish that enhances the curls’ shape and dimension, rather than flattening them with a uniform color.
- Knowledge of Hair Health: A skilled colorist is aware of the importance of maintaining the health of curly hair during the coloring process. They employ conditioning treatments and choose color products that minimize damage, ensuring that the hair remains hydrated and vibrant post-treatment.
- Ability to Customize Color: The best colorists take into account the individual’s skin tone, eye color, and personal style when recommending shades. This personalized approach ensures that the color complements the natural beauty of the client’s curls and enhances their overall look.
- Familiarity with Curly Hair Care: A knowledgeable colorist can provide tips and product recommendations for aftercare specific to curly hair. They understand that maintaining the integrity of colored curls requires specific products and routines to avoid dryness and frizz.

What Techniques Do Top Colorists Use for Curly Hair?
Top colorists use a variety of specialized techniques to enhance curly hair while maintaining its health and vibrancy.
- Balayage: This freehand painting technique allows colorists to apply color in a way that mimics natural sun-kissed highlights, enhancing the curls’ texture and movement without overwhelming them. Balayage typically requires less maintenance than full color, making it a great choice for curly hair which can be more prone to damage.
- Ombre: Ombre involves a gradual blend of color from dark at the roots to lighter at the ends, which can create a stunning contrast against curly hair. This technique allows for dimension and depth, giving curls a more dynamic look while also being low-maintenance as the roots grow out.
- Foil Highlights: Foiling is a precise coloring technique that involves wrapping sections of hair in foil to achieve bright, defined highlights. This method can be tailored to curly hair by selecting specific curls to highlight, ensuring that the overall look remains balanced and not overly uniform.
- Color Melting: This technique blends multiple shades seamlessly, creating a soft transition between colors that can enhance the natural movement of curls. Color melting is particularly effective for curly hair as it allows for a multi-dimensional look that complements the texture without harsh lines.
- Root Shadowing: Root shadowing involves applying a darker color at the roots and gradually blending it into a lighter shade towards the ends. This technique not only offers a beautiful gradient but also helps to disguise any regrowth, which is particularly helpful for curls that may require less frequent touch-ups.
- Glossing: Gloss treatments can enhance the shine and vibrancy of curly hair after coloring, making the curls appear healthier and more defined. Glossing also helps to seal in moisture, which is crucial for maintaining the integrity of curly hair that can often be dry.
- Color Correction: For clients with previous color that may not have turned out as desired, color correction is a specialized service that colorists offer to adjust the hair tone. This process often requires a tailored approach to ensure that the final color works harmoniously with the client’s natural curls.

What Can You Expect During a Color Consultation for Curly Hair?
During a color consultation for curly hair, you can expect a thorough assessment of your hair type, color preferences, and maintenance needs.
- Initial Assessment: The best colorist for curly hair will begin with an in-depth evaluation of your hair’s texture, porosity, and overall health. This helps the stylist understand how your curls may react to different coloring techniques and products.
- Color Options Discussion: You will discuss various color options that complement your skin tone and style. The colorist will provide insights into shades that can enhance your natural curls and how certain colors may require different maintenance levels.
- Techniques and Application: The stylist will explain the different coloring techniques suitable for curly hair, such as balayage or foiling. These methods are tailored to ensure that the color blends beautifully with the natural curl pattern, preventing damage and ensuring an even application.
- Maintenance Tips: Expect to receive personalized tips on how to care for your colored curls post-application. This includes recommendations for specific products that maintain moisture, prevent fade, and enhance the vibrancy of the color.
- Cost and Time Estimates: Finally, the consultation will cover the estimated cost and time required for the coloring service. The best colorist will provide a transparent breakdown to help you plan accordingly and set realistic expectations for your appointment.
